OXENSTJERNA, Johan Gabriel (1750-1818). Arbeten. Stockholm: C. Delén, 1815-1826. 5 volumes, 8° (201 x 115mm). Engraved title with neo-classical ornament by Samuel Andersson (1773-1857). (Light spotting in vol. V). Contemporary half sheep, spines gilt, yellow edges (a little worn and chipped). Provenance: Otton von Feilitzen (inscription on flyleaf -- M. Höjer? (inscribed on pastedown vol. I) -- Tidö Bibliotek (bookplate of the von Schinkel period of ownership). Tidö Castle was owned by the Oxenstiernas from 1609-1759 and thereafter by the von Schinkel family.
OXENSTJERNA, Johan Gabriel. Äreminne öfver Konung Gustaf III. Stockholm: J.C. Holmberg, 1794. 4° (228 x 189mm). Engraved vignette by Johan Frederik Martin (1755-1816). (Marginal dampstaining, spotted.) Later half sheep (extremities rubbed, stitching holes from earlier binding visible). Provenance: inscription dated 1824 on pastedown -- Swen Wawrinsky (booklabel, inscribed on title, stamp on endleaf); and another.
Oxenstierna was an aristocratic poet, official, diplomat and member of the Swedish Academy from 1786. He was particulary influential in introducing rural, nature-observing and sentimental themes into Swedish poetry. (7)
